How to use this inspection record
- Confirm the inspection ID and date. Verify that the inspection number (80797329) and date (Feb 8, 2024) match what the carrier or broker has provided you. The inspection ID is FMCSA's permanent identifier and will not change.
- Review every cited violation code. Click through each violation code in the table below to read the underlying FMCSR section. The severity weight column tells you which citations carry the most weight in the SMS scoring algorithm.
- Check the OOS flags. An OOS order was issued. The Vehicle OOS / Driver OOS badges at the top of this page tell you which side of the cab triggered it; until the cited defects were corrected, the carrier could not legally continue operating.
